Tidy and well-behaved, Muhlenbergia rigens (Deer Grass) is a warm season perennial grass forming a dense clump of slender pointed leaves, up to 3 ft. long (90 cm), ranging from bright green to pale silver-green. Deer grass (Muhlenbergia rigens) is a fine-textured bunchgrass with erect to gracefully arching grayish green leaves to three feet tall and four feet wide and a haze of tawny or silvery gray mid-summer flowers on stems that rise two feet above the foliage. filipes, Muhlenbergia filipes, Podostemum filipes, Gulf Hairawn Muhle, Gulf Muhly Grass, Purple Muhly. Muhlenbergia rigens (Deer Grass) - This wonderful warm season California native bunch grass typically has foliage to 3 feet in height and the plant gets to 5 feet when in flower with an equal spread.
